What does change in AR mean?
The change in money owed to the company by its customers.
How do you interpret change in AR?
An increase consumes cash, while a decrease releases cash; rapid increases relative to revenue may signal collection issues.
How does change in AR compare across companies?
Highly dependent on the company's commercialization stage and customer payment terms.
